Lighthouse Journalism found a video being widely shared on social media. The video looked like a snippet from a news show. It featured former Education Minister Dharmendra Pradhan.
In the video Dharmendra Pradhan was seen threatening to expose the BJP after he was asked to step down. During the investigation we found that the video is a deepfake and the former Education Minister did not threaten to expose the BJP.

Investigation:
We started the investigation by running a reverse image search on the keyframes obtained from the video. We cropped the keyframes and then ran a reverse image search.
This led us to a news report uploaded on the YouTube channel of NDTV over 9 days ago.
The anchor in the frame was the same as in the viral video.
We then ran a reverse image search on the keyframe featuring Dharmendra Pradhan, this led us to a video of a press conference led by former Education Minister, posted by ANI over two months ago.
This was a detailed media briefing on NEET paper leak and re-examination. In the entire video he did not threaten to expose the BJP.
We then ran the voice from the video through the Hiya Audio detector in the InVid tool. The tool detected 90 percent voice cloning.

Conclusion: Former Education Minister Dharmendra Pradhan did not threaten to expose the BJP. The viral video is a deepfake. The viral claim is false.
